[發明專利]基于VxWorks的光刻機雙工件臺通信方法及裝置有效
| 申請號: | 201310381928.4 | 申請日: | 2013-08-28 |
| 公開(公告)號: | CN103439866A | 公開(公告)日: | 2013-12-11 |
| 發明(設計)人: | 陳興林;劉川;劉楊;畢延帥 | 申請(專利權)人: | 哈爾濱工業大學 |
| 主分類號: | G03F7/20 | 分類號: | G03F7/20;H04L29/06 |
| 代理公司: | 哈爾濱市松花江專利商標事務所 23109 | 代理人: | 岳泉清 |
| 地址: | 150001 黑龍*** | 國省代碼: | 黑龍江;23 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 基于 vxworks 光刻 雙工 通信 方法 裝置 | ||
技術領域
本發明涉及一種通信方法及裝置,特別涉及一種基于VxWorks的光刻機雙工件臺通信方法及裝置。
背景技術
VxWorks是美國Wind?River公司開發的一種實時操作系統,其以良好的可靠性和卓越的實時性被廣泛應用于很多實時性要求極高的領域。網絡處理中最消耗時間的操作是緩沖區拷貝和計算/驗算校驗和,傳統使用TCP或IP協議的VxWorks操作系統通信,對鏈路層的支持有限,并且需要經過系統任務的轉發,實時性比較差,因此,提高網絡的通信速度,減小網絡處理中時間的消耗成為一種必要。
發明內容
本發明的目的是為了解決傳統使用TCP或IP協議的VxWorks操作系統通信實時性差的問題,本發明提供一種基于VxWorks的光刻機雙工件臺通信方法及裝置。
本發明的基于VxWorks的光刻機雙工件臺通信方法,
它是基于雙工作臺光刻機、上位機和VME工控機實現的,
所述VME工控機內插有運動控制卡,所述運動控制卡嵌入有指令解算模型、控制模型、電機模型和工件臺數學模型;所述運動控制卡用于采集雙工作臺光刻機的運行數據,同時發送控制數據給所述雙工作臺光刻機;
指令解算模型,用于對輸入的指令進行解算,并將解算后的指令發送給控制模型;
控制模型,用于對接收的指令進行整定,生成電機控制量和工件臺控制量,并分將電機控制量發送給電機模型,將工件臺控制量發送給工件臺數學模型;
電機模型,用于根據電機控制量驅動實際臺體中的電機工作;
工件臺數學模型用于根據工作臺控制量驅動實際臺體中的工作臺運動;
上位機和VME工控機內均裝有VxWorks操作系統并接入以太網;
所述上位機內嵌入有上位機軟件,通過所述上位機軟件實現下述步驟:
當接收到操作指令時,將所述操作指令轉換為VME工控機接受的格式的命令,并采用TCP通信協議通過socket?API接口將所述命令下傳到VME工控機的步驟;
當采用UDP通信協議接收到VME工控機發送的執行結果信息并顯示的步驟;
所述VME工控機內嵌入有VME工控機軟件,通過所述VME工控機軟件實現下述步驟:
采用TCP通信協議從socket?ZBUF?API接口接收上位機發送的命令,將所述命令添加到指令接收緩沖隊列的步驟;
從指令接收緩沖隊列取出命令,根據所述命令執行相應的軟硬件操作,操作結束后將執行結果信息添加到數據發送緩沖隊列的步驟;
從數據發送緩沖隊列取出執行結果信息,采用UDP通信協議通過socket?ZBUF?API接口將所述執行結果信息發送給上位機的步驟;
當接收到硬件中斷信號時,執行已經被綁定的中斷服務程序,中斷服務程序通知中斷服務任務,所述中斷服務任務將中斷信息添加到數據發送緩沖隊列的步驟;
當接收到硬件輪詢信號時,將硬件輪詢信號添加到數據發送緩沖隊列的步驟。
基于VxWorks的光刻機雙工件臺通信裝置,
它是基于雙工作臺光刻機、上位機和VME工控機實現的,
所述VME工控機內插有運動控制卡,所述運動控制卡嵌入有指令解算模型、控制模型、電機模型和工件臺數學模型;所述運動控制卡用于采集雙工作臺光刻機的運行數據,同時發送控制數據給所述雙工作臺光刻機;
指令解算模型,用于對輸入的指令進行解算,并將解算后的指令發送給控制模型;
控制模型,用于對接收的指令進行整定,生成電機控制量和工件臺控制量,并分將電機控制量發送給電機模型,將工件臺控制量發送給工件臺數學模型;
電機模型,用于根據電機控制量驅動實際臺體中的電機工作;
工件臺數學模型用于根據工作臺控制量驅動實際臺體中的工作臺運動;
上位機和VME工控機內均裝有VxWorks操作系統并接入以太網;
所述上位機包括如下裝置:
當接收到操作指令時,將所述操作指令轉換為VME工控機接受的格式的命令,并采用TCP通信協議通過socket?API接口將所述命令下傳到VME工控機的裝置;
當采用UDP通信協議接收到VME工控機發送的執行結果信息并顯示的裝置;
所述VME工控機包括如下裝置:
采用TCP通信協議從socket?ZBUF?API接口接收上位機發送的命令,將所述命令添加到指令接收緩沖隊列的裝置;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于哈爾濱工業大學,未經哈爾濱工業大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310381928.4/2.html,轉載請聲明來源鉆瓜專利網。





